How Initial Assessments Help You Tackle Water Damage

When water damage occurs in a property, conducting an initial assessment is essential for effective restoration. This procedure involves locating the source of the water intrusion, gauging the severity of the damage, and determining affected areas. A detailed assessment empowers restoration professionals to categorize the water—ranging from clean to gray or black—guiding appropriate response measures.

Furthermore, the evaluation helps in recognizing potential risks, such as mold development or structural weakness, which can hinder the restoration process. By cataloging the discoveries, professionals can sewage backup cleanup develop a personalized restoration strategy that focuses on the most significant areas first. This strategic approach not only minimizes further deterioration but also maximizes the use of resources. Ultimately, an precise initial evaluation lays the foundation for a successful rehabilitation plan, guaranteeing that every required measure is implemented to return the property to its original state effectively and efficiently.

What Follows Water Extraction: Efficient Drying Solutions?

After water extraction, the next significant step in the restoration process involves implementing effective drying solutions. This step is vital for preventing further deterioration and supporting a thorough restoration. Professionals utilize industrial-grade dehumidifiers and air movers to reduce moisture levels in the affected areas. Dehumidifiers draw out excess moisture from the air, while air movers enhance airflow to speed up the drying process.

Measuring moisture content is crucial during this stage. Specialists commonly employ hygrometers to confirm all affected materials, including walls and floors, reach acceptable dryness levels. According to the severity of the water intrusion, specialized tools like thermal imaging cameras may be employed to detect hidden moisture pockets.

Furthermore, adequate ventilation is essential; making use of exhaust fans and open windows can boost airflow. Overall, a systematic drying process ensures the structural integrity is maintained and limits the chances of subsequent complications including mold proliferation.

How to Avoid Water Damage in the Future

Protecting against future water damage necessitates routine maintenance and forward-thinking strategies. Homeowners are encouraged to periodically check their property for water leaks, with particular focus on roofs, gutters, and plumbing systems. Tackling small problems early can stop more serious issues from developing over time.

Implementing sump pump systems and servicing drainage systems can help divert excess water away from the foundation. Furthermore, maintaining proper grading around the home will minimize moisture buildup near the home.

Consistently cleaning gutters and downspouts is critical for proper water management. Additionally, incorporating water-resistant materials for basement and crawl space areas can reduce the risk of damage.

Ultimately, measuring moisture levels inside the home can stop mold from developing, which often accompanies water damage. By applying these strategies, individuals can greatly minimize the likelihood of future moisture-related concerns, preserving their property and protecting their investment for years to come.

What Are the Signs of Hidden Water Damage?

Signs of hidden water damage include musty odors, unexplained mold growth, water stains on walls or ceilings, warped floors, and rising humidity levels. Early detection is essential to prevent further structural damage and health risks.

What Immediate Actions Should I Take Following a Water Leak?

Immediately after a water leak happens, one should shut off the water supply, disconnect electrical appliances, and clear away the excess water. After that, completely drying the affected area and evaluating damage are necessary to stopping further complications.
